Joshua 24:14(NRSV)
14 “Now therefore revere the LORD, and serve him
in sincerity and in faithfulness; put away the gods that your ancestors
served beyond the River and in Egypt, and serve the LORD.
15 Now if you are unwilling to serve the LORD,
choose this day whom you will serve, whether the gods your ancestors served
in the region beyond the River or the gods of the Amorites in whose land you
are living; but as for me and my household, we will serve the LORD.”

1Then
God spoke all these words:
2I
am the LORD your God, who brought you out of the land of Egypt, out of the
house of slavery;
(1) 3you
shall have no other gods before me.
(2) 4You
shall not make for yourself an idol, whether in the form of anything that is
in heaven above, or that is on the earth beneath, or that is in the water
under the earth. 5You
shall not bow down to them or worship them; for I the LORD your God am a
jealous God, punishing children for the iniquity of parents, to the third
and the fourth generation of those who reject me, 6but
showing steadfast love to the thousandth generation of those who love me and
keep my commandments.
(3) 7You
shall not make wrongful use of the name of the LORD your God, for the LORD
will not acquit anyone who misuses his name.
(4) 8Remember
the sabbath day, and keep it holy. 9Six
days you shall labor and do all your work. 10But
the seventh day is a sabbath to the LORD your God; you shall not do any
work—you, your son or your daughter, your male or female slave, your
livestock, or the alien resident in your towns. 11For
in six days the LORD made heaven and earth, the sea, and all that is in
them, but rested the seventh day; therefore the LORD blessed the sabbath day
and consecrated it.
(5) 12Honor
your father and your mother, so that your days may be long in the land that
the LORD your God is giving you.
(6) 13You
shall not murder.
(7) 14You
shall not commit adultery.
(8) 15You
shall not steal.
(9) 16You
shall not bear false witness against your neighbor.
(10) 17You
shall not covet your neighbor’s house; you shall not covet your neighbor’s
wife, or male or female slave, or ox, or donkey, or anything that belongs to
your neighbor.
